Compaq Portable - The Compaq Portable, sometimes referred to as the Compaq Portable XT, was the first product in the Compaq portable series to be brought out by Compaq Computer Corporation. Not only that, but it was the first ever almost-completely IBM PC compatible personal computer not manufactured by IBM, and also the first ever IBM PC compatible portable computer.

Handheld PC - A Handheld PC, or H/PC for short, is a Microsoft term for a computer built around a form factor which is smaller than any standard notebook PC or laptop.

Mini-PC - Mini-PC is a shrunken laptop PC that would weigh about a pound and rest comfortably in two hands.

Compaq - Compaq was a personal computer company founded in 1982 by Rod Canion, Jim Harris and Bill Murto. During the 1980s Compaq produced some of the first IBM PC compatible computers at a low-cost.
